One problem related to tank assembly has been reported for the 1996 Chevrolet Caprice. The most recently reported issues are listed below.
Wires for fuel sending unit have burned and melted, including electrical fuel connector plug inside gas tank, causing a fire hazard. Consumer has replaced unit, and noticed that new part was redesigned and been modified, indicating a problem with old design. Consumer still has original unit.
